I love this thing! I didn't realize how much I'd appreciate having a GPS on the bike until I got one. The only slight negative is that it doesn't have voice recognition, so changing destinations requires a stop (you might be able to do it while riding, but I'm not going to try doing it). Even when no route is entered, just using it as a moving map, Its really great. Easy to see, responsive, securely mounted, what's not to like?

I had a different Garmin that broke this summer and I didn't hesitate to buy another one. The last one wasn't built for a motorcycle, so that may have helped it's demise. This one is built to take the bumps of a road and has more options for travel routes. I use this mainly for our chapter summer fun run book where I load in all of our stops for the summer and call them up as I go to the different stops. Easy to load in stops and add addresses as I go. It takes you right to the door, even if it's 50 miles off because of human error (check the info that you type in). The mounting hardware that comes with it is very secure and I'm not afraid of losing the unit.

Easy to operate even with gloves on. Keyboard is spread over 2 different screens making it cumbersome and difficult to operate quickly. Route settings don't allow for differentiation between divided highways (interstates) and 2 lane state highways. Route calculator has a difficulty with international borders.
